OPAL MALE (pavo cristatus mutation brown and opal)

This mutation has the same color pattern as the India Blue. The crest is fan-
shaped. The entire bird is brown in color. The head and neck feathers have
a distinct aquamarine tint. The wings are a light brown with brown barring.
The saddle and train feathers may have an opal tint appearance, depending on the light. The ocelli are formed by a dull black surrounded by a broad ring of opal and deep copper color. Opal breed true offspring when bred Opal to Opal.
